3D Knitting: A Beanie That Works with Your Head
The standard beanie is essentially a flat piece of fabric folded into a tube and cinched at the top. It fits because the ribbing stretches, not because the hat was shaped to fit a head. That's fine for quick production, but it's not ideal for how a hat actually behaves on your head.
BEAMS and HICOSAKA teamed up in 2026 to release a "Neo 3D Knit Cap" that uses a completely different construction method. Instead of knitting a flat piece and forcing it into shape, the Neo 3D cap changes the knitting direction during production .
This technique creates three-dimensional relief directly in the fabric. The design incorporates a technique called "引き返し編み" (turn-back knitting)—changing the knitting direction mid-process to create three areas of raised volume and shadow on the surface . The result is a hat with more structure, more depth, and a shadow effect that flat knits can't achieve.
The most practical benefit is stability. The lining's volume has also been increased, which means the hat stays put even during extended wear without losing its shape . A beanie formed using 3D knitting stays in place because it's shaped to the head from the start, not forced into shape by a closing seam. It doesn't stretch out as quickly, and it doesn't deform after repeated wear.
What this means for a customer: A 3D-knit beanie should fit more consistently and hold its shape longer. The hat doesn't get "tired" in the same way a traditional knit does.
Seamless Construction: Comfort Without Compromise
Seamless construction is the other major shift happening in beanie manufacturing. Instead of knitting separate panels and sewing them together, seamless beanies are knitted in one continuous piece, with no seams at the crown or the sides.
Brands like Lacoste are adopting "seamless 3D knit" construction with a 5-gauge wool knit that regulates temperature . The result is a hat with no rough spots—no thick seams pressing against your scalp, no ridges that can cause irritation. Oleana's Lazy Kate beanie is knitted seamlessly in one piece using a 3D knitting technique from soft alpaca wool .
Some brands are adding functional materials. FreshService's Thermal Rib Knit Watch Cap incorporates ceramic fibers that release far-infrared radiation for warmth, plus antibacterial and deodorant finishing . This kind of material innovation adds a practical benefit: you can wear it more often without worrying about odor buildup.
Seamless construction isn't just a gimmick. It solves an actual problem. A seamless beanie should feel smoother against the scalp. There's no seam to press or irritate, and the fabric is designed to be worn for longer periods without discomfort.
Why This Matters Now
These innovations are happening at the same time for a reason. Consumers are demanding more from their basics. A beanie is no longer just a beanie—it's a piece of clothing that needs to perform. As the market for premium accessories grows, the brands that invest in construction details will be the ones that stand out.
The BEAMS x HICOSAKA collaboration is priced at ¥16,500 (about $110 USD), positioning it squarely in the premium category . The 3D knitting process takes more time and skill than standard flat knitting, and the materials—100% wool in the HICOSAKA case—are higher quality than most mass-market beanies. But as these techniques become more common, they'll start to appear at more accessible price points.
The trend: 3D knitting and seamless construction are becoming more accessible. They're still relatively new, but they're starting to appear across a wider range of price points.
